How to remove my name from the charge sheet filed by police?

      If you feel that your name has been wrongly included as an accused person, in the charge sheet filed by the police, and also that there is no evidence to support the charge against you, then you can try to file a discharge application before the trial court. If successful, you may be discharged from the case and will not be prosecuted.

      Since the police has already filed the charge sheet, it may not be possible for the police to remove your name from the charge sheet. You can apply to the court through the discharge application, as mentioned above, for this purpose.

      Another option could be to approach the high court under Section 482 Cr.P.C. for quashing of the criminal proceedings against you, but the high court may not generally entertain such petition at this early stage and my instead ask you to approach the trial court with a discharge application.

      Other than these, the only option would be to face the trial and get acquitted from the case by proving your innocence.
